【編者按】對比傳統RDBMS領域,NoSQL界的廝殺顯然更加激烈。而在這場沒有硝煙的戰場中,MongoDB和Cassandra無疑是風頭最勁的兩個產品。但是如果你著眼HBase,各大熱門技術(比如Spark、Hadoop)及知名廠商(比如微軟、Splice Machine)的支持無疑描繪出一個更美好的未來,下面我們一起看Gigaom Andrew帶來的分析。
以下為譯文:在NoSQL數據庫領域,統治產品無疑當屬MongDB和DataStax Enterprise(一個領先的Apache Cassandra發行版)。然而本周的兩條新聞頭條卻開始關注一個盡管很頑強,但知名度低的選手――Apache HBase,這個幾乎包含在任何主流Hadoop發行版的NoSQL數據庫。
Mongo的挑戰
聚焦上一周,有兩個事件值得關注――7歲的MongoDB任命了第三任CEO,以及主打HBase的初創公司Splice Machine新一輪融資超過300萬美元。對比MongoDB和HBase,無論是獨自還是聯合發展,后者都沒有任何超越前者的跡象。最終,即將離職的MongoDB CEO Max Schireson將其離職原因歸結于需要頻繁奔波于公司在Palo Alto和New York的兩個總部,以及其他的一些工作需求。
MongoDB似乎詮釋了快速發展的苦惱,不僅僅表現在經營管理層,也表現在技術發展層面上――從許多開發者和圈內朋友那得知,MongoDB在大規模下表現非常差,不管是集群大小還是數據攝入體積。
分歧中的發展
但不得不說,HBase的勢頭正在上揚,并且不存在MongoDB發展中所遇見的問題。雖然HBase沒有像MongoDB及Cassandra背后那些龍頭企業撐腰,但其發展已經很好了:
展望HBase未來
從Splice Machine和微軟的產品來看,HBase是一個兼容了其他數據技術的NoSQL數據庫。同時,人們對“Data Lake”架構日益增長的興趣也增加了HBase成功的幾率。對于HBase的持續發展,讓我們拭目以待。
原文鏈接:Is HBase’s slow and steady approach winning the NoSQL race?(編譯/仲浩 審校/魏偉)